Output ef8ff6b74bf817e1a64efcff34c8347dd87fd29f1f9e18501afd6c7e97d8b022:1

value
27989812
script pubkey
OP_0 OP_PUSHBYTES_20 8ef644769cf1c5f22c2ce6b9a560d7a478600e34
address
ltc1q3mmyga5u78zlytpvu6u62cxh53uxqr35vg7pc8
transaction
ef8ff6b74bf817e1a64efcff34c8347dd87fd29f1f9e18501afd6c7e97d8b022
spent
true